Water Reducing Admixtures (WRAs), sometimes referred to as plasticizers, are designed to free trapped water that is present in concrete mixtures and are used in a variety of applications to ensure or improve workability. When cement clinker is ground, electrical charges are created on the surface of the particles. During concrete mixing, cement particles bond together and trap water. The WRA breaks the bond and frees the trapped water which is then available to aid workability and increase cement hydration.
